I think I have the early signs of needing a new TCT. Americans love the Billman TCT, but it's quite expensive when you consider you have to give him your old TCT.

I've also read that some people have had failures on the early ones. One person had problems with gen 1-4 and moved to another. I was wondering if all the problems are sorted with the 10th iteration. I know he has a lifetime warranty, but sending back and forth to USA is a bit of a ballache, and I haven't read anywhere who pays postage.

So basically, I'm wondering if anyone who has the Gen-X TCT from Billman has had a problem?

OEM is actually the cheapest option. Toda and Ballade are other options. Ballade also has a lifetime warranty (again though, what about postage costs).

In terms of actual monetary outlay, Toda and Billman seem fairly similar, but with Toda I'll get to keep my old TCT, which to me is a good thing.
